Every plugin needs a manifest, even with no config. Runtime-registered tools
must be listed in `contracts.tools` so OpenClaw can discover the owning
plugin without loading every plugin runtime. Plugins should also declare
`activation.onStartup` intentionally. This example sets it to `true`. See
[Manifest](/plugins/manifest) for the full schema. The canonical ClawHub
publish snippets live in `docs/snippets/plugin-publish/`.

Every tool registered with `api.registerTool(...)` must also be declared in the
plugin manifest:
```json
{
"contracts": {
"tools": ["my_tool", "workflow_tool"]
}
}
```
